Magritte Painting Sells for Record \$121 Million
A René Magritte painting sold for over \$121 million at a Christie's auction, setting a record for the Surrealist artist. The sale is seen as a positive sign in the slowing art market.

Ukraine Strikes Russia with US Missiles, Escalating War
Ukraine used US-made missiles to strike targets deep in Russia, marking a major escalation in the war. Russia responded with an updated nuclear doctrine.

Israel-Hezbollah Ceasefire Talks
US envoy Amos Hochstein is mediating a ceasefire deal between Israel and Hezbollah, facing challenges over Israeli demands for operational freedom in southern Lebanon.

Trump's Gaetz Nomination Sparks Political Crisis
Donald Trump's controversial nomination of Matt Gaetz for Attorney General is causing a major political showdown, pitting Trump against several Republican senators who have serious concerns about Gaetz's past conduct.
